SPECIAL SERIES – Pep Talk Episode 19
While we have all learned a lot living through this pandemic some companies in the industry have been around to see other major events that have rattled the nation. This week, we talk with Jonathan Mize, CEO and president of Kansas-based distributor Blish-Mize. Next year, Blish-Mize will turn 150 years old and Jonathan shares some insights into how the company and its customers are making it through this pandemic and where he sees the industry heading post-COVID-19.

SPECIAL SERIES – Pep Talk Episode 7
When the team at Heisler’s Hardware in Spearfish, South Dakota, heard that their community food bank needed some help to keep up with the increased demand, they didn’t waste any time developing a plan. In this episode, we talk with Pam Heisler and Kelsee Colgrove to learn the very special story behind how they stepped up and worked with other local business leaders to provide much needed assistance to their neighbors in need.

About Dan Tratensek

In his position as publisher of Hardware Retailing magazine, Dan has the opportunity to visit with independent retailers of all types and sizes and use these visits to shape the editorial direction of the magazine to meet the needs of the independent hardware retail market. Dan also oversees NRHA’s other publishing projects, which include a range of special interest publications, contract publishing titles, online content and more. Dan formerly worked as an editor and reporter for Hardware Retailing and has been involved in business journalism and news reporting for the past two decades
